UMSL students Nabehah Azeez (right) and Sophie Powell perform a scene from the student production “Intimate Apparel,” staged in the Lee Theater at the Touhill. Niyi Coker, the E. Desmond Lee Endowed Professor of African/African American Studies, directed the play, which was written by Lynn Nottage. The picture, taken by campus photographer August Jennewein, is the latest to be featured at Eye on UMSL.
